The Operations & Relationship Manager (ORM) role is to facilitate the integration and engagement of existing and prospective tenants and provide day-to-day management of the sites. The role works closely with the CHP Property team to help ensure the safe and efficient running of the site whilst working closely with tenants to maximise tenant satisfaction and improve utilisation.   • Act as the main point of contact for tenant liaison and coordination; promote positive working relationships and integration amongst tenants; and deal with day to day queries from site occupiers. Arrange, chair and facilitate tenant meetings (including site user groups and any health and safety related meetings as may be required). Promote engagement between tenants and encourage idea sharing and problem solving. Seek to action, resolve or escalate tenant issues as appropriate on their behalf. Act as tenant representative in feeding back queries about soft or hard FM services to the CRM/SORM and Facilities Management (FM) providers on behalf of tenants. Coordinate tenant variation requests, obtain full details of the request and liaise with the CRM/SORM accordingly to arrange the necessary consent. Coordinate and provide support to site users on tenant new work requests, provide assistance in following the approvals procedure, as appropriate and liaise with the Helpdesk.

  • Coordinate and accompany visiting contractors on site visits in relation to tenant new work requests, tenant variation requests and specifically accompany the Health, Safety, Security and Fire officers for the purposes of implementing fire risk assessments.

    Community Health Partnerships (CHP) is wholly owned by the Secretary of State for Health and Social Care and a key member of the NHS Family. Set up in 2001, we work to improve community-based health and wellbeing services by providing and managing high quality NHS estate. Through our LIFT (Local Improvement Finance Trust) programme, 350 local health care buildings were designed, built and funded and are currently operated, with CHP acting as Head Tenant in most. We have a head office in Manchester and regional offices in Birmingham and London and support a hybrid working model wherever possible in line with the needs of the business.
